A daughter’s grief … A mother’s madness … And a daring act of love that defied every law …
The best mystery writer anywhere in the English-speaking world. -The Boston Globe
Mopsa, driven by a past scarred by madness and violence. Benet, stricken by the most grievous loss any woman can bear. Carol, trapped in a life of crushing drabness no lover can change. Three mothers joined by a single thread of terror, whirled into a spiral of kidnapping, murder, and a final, reckless affirmation of love.
Praise for The Tree of Hands
A consummate artist who commands style, plot and character … A storyteller of a high order. -Washington Post
An excellent piece of suspense writing. -San Diego Union
Densely plotted, deeply emotional … The design of this book is brilliant… . It moves forward in a series of inexorable events that leave the reader panting from suspense and shaken from the sheer emotion of it all. -Cleveland Plain Dealer
Here is Ruth Rendell at the top of her form-topping it, in fact, with a suspense chiller enchanted by a contemporary topicality that strikes to the heart. -Judith Christ
